Actress Mia Farrow is expected to testify next week at the war crimes trial of Charles Taylor, the former president of Liberia who prosecutors allege funded a brutal civil war using blood diamonds.

Her appearance is scheduled for Monday, according to the United Nations.

It comes five days after supermodel Naomi Campbell also testified at the United Nations-backed Special Court for Sierra Leone.

Campbell said she received “dirty-looking” uncut diamonds as a gift after a dinner hosted by Nelson Mandela in 1997.

Taylor was a guest at the dinner party.

The supermodel said she did not know who sent her the stones, which were delivered to her room in Pretoria late at night.

She said she was not aware they were diamonds at the time.

“I'm used to seeing them [diamonds) shiny and in a box,” she testified Thursday.
